211:CK Review

After a failed bank robbery, you are stuck in a jam. Can you survive by touching and shaking your phone to the end? The action shooter sees players taking the role of a bank robber Charles Kemp making his escape from law enforcement. The game consists of three stages each with a certain difficulty level ranging from Easy, Medium and Hard. The game offers weapon upgrades, item pick ups and much more. Y

Skullgirls Mobile Debuts in the App Stores

Skullgirls,” the fast-paced, 2D blockbuster fighting game franchise, debuted today on the App Store for iPhone, iPod touch and iPad, and Google Play for Android devices. Developed by Hidden Variable Studios, published by Autumn Games, and distributed by social platform giant LINE, “Skullgirls” is now available in North and South America, Europe, Australia, New Zealand, and the Philippines. The game will be coming soon to Asia and additional territories.

Cosmunity Connects Geeks around the World Through Newly Launched Social Marketplace

For iOS and Android, Cosmunity gives fans of anime, gaming, comics, ckosplay and more a place to show off their inner geek and buy/sell pop culture-related goods and services Dallas, TX – February 21, 2017 – Cosmunity, the first social marketplace for your inner geek, today announced the public launch of its mobile application, providing geek and pop culture lovers a dedicated community and onestop-shop to enhance their fandom. Cosmunity is free to download on the Google Play and Apple App Store. Fans love engaging with like-minded individuals in the geek culture community – both on a social level, as well as through transactions with their favorite vendors and peers. Cosmunity uses innovative app technology to aggregate and connect fans of anime, cosplay, comics, and gaming by enhancing and facilitating real world interactions. Social.

Cosmunity provides a comic-style feed of photos, video, events and items for sale, easily accessed through the app. Users can discuss the latest video games and movies, discover and follow favorite cosplayers, celebrities and friends, or grow a dedicated following of their own within this exclusively geek platform. “Let’s face it – we all have an inner geek and are fanatical fans of something. So why isn’t there a place where the community can all connect with like-minded individuals? After attending several Comic Con events, we realized there was a major missing piece to the puzzle,” said Cole Egger, Cosmunity co-founder and CEO.

“When the convention ended and the dust had settled, we heard grumblings of what many called ‘Post-Con Depression.’ Everyone was bummed that they had to leave their community until the next event. We created Cosmunity to solve that.” Cosmunity is the go-to-geek app for anime, cosplay, comic and gaming fans that allows users to explore and connect with others who share their passions. As a lifetime geek and advisor to Cosmunity, Ming Chen of AMC’s Comic Book Men enthusiastically agrees, “Cosmunity is unlike any other app on the market for the geek community. I can go to Cosmunity and find everything I need; friends, event info, discover new content and find my favorite convention retailers all in one place.”

Marketplace:  The wide variety of items available on the Cosmunity platform today range from $5 to $38,000. Partnerships with individual craftsmen, artists and retailers offer fans a unique digital peer-to-peer shopping experience where geeks can find and purchase one-of-akind items they wouldn’t have found otherwise. Cosmunity provides an outstanding opportunity for industry vendors to easily list items for sale on the platform via their desktop uploader. Currently available for purchase on Cosmunity are props, apparel, jewelry, collectible items, full cosplay costumes, prints, comic books, artwork and more. Cosmunity integrates PayPal and AfterShip to ensure all transactions are tracked and handled securely, giving users confidence that their coveted item will arrive without compromise. One Cosmunity partner and well-known comic book dealer, Metropolis Comics, currently owns the most expensive vintage comic book ever sold, the 1938 copy of Action Comics #1, graded CGC 9.0. It also recently listed a copy of Amazing Fantasy #15 — which marks the first appearance of Spiderman — for sale on Cosmunity.

“We love Cosmunity because it’s easy to use and provides a terrific marketplace for us to list our collectibles for sale,” said Brandon Pierce Peck, Internet Sales Director, Metropolis Comics. “But more importantly, we love the community they have created. There’s no other place where fans can gather online to interact, trade collectibles, and pretty much just geek out. It’s basically Comic Con in the palm of your hand.”

Events: For most geeks, the highlight of their fandom is attending their favorite convention, event or show - most notably Comic Con, Anime Expo and E3. Cosmunity has a separate Events tab where users can find local events, and chat with other attendees before, during and after the event, helping geeks make meaningful connections. Cosmunity will also have an active presence at industry events across the United States, including its sponsorship of Steve Wozniak’s Silicon Valley Comic Con taking place April 21-23, 2017 in San Jose, California. A Normal Lost Phone (Review)

A Normal Lost Phone (Review)

 In this piece of "meta-fiction" players play themselves having discovered a smartphone. To unravel the story, players must snoop through the phone to find information about it's owner Sam, and as they uncover passwords and messages, they learn about the life of Sam, the owner of said phone.

"Final Fantasy Brave Exvius" Mobile Game Coming Summer from SQUARE ENIX and gumi

A brand-new FINAL FANTASY experience, will launch for free (with in-app purchases) on iOS and Android devices this summer. The hit title has already drawn in more than six million players in Japan and is an entirely new role-playing adventure for the mobile generation. The title brings the classic FINAL FANTASY lore with legendary heroes from the franchise.

Adventurers will follow two knights of the kingdom of Grandshelt, and a young girl who suddenly appears before them, as they begin their quest to pursue a highly sought after crystal. Players will make their way through various types of dungeons to search for items, collect gil, uncover hidden paths, and venture new routes.


The title features:
·        Traditional, turn-based gameplay with streamlined battle mechanics and intuitive touch controls, making it easy to pick up and play for newcomers as well as long-time fans
·        Players will be able to move their characters through fields and dungeons to search for items, hidden paths, and new routes.
·        High-quality CG animations of FINAL FANTASY summons
·        Appearances from new and characters from past titles like the Warrior of Light, Cecil, Vivi, and Terra
·        A complete RPG experience in an easy, portable format for mobile phones

“Fairy Tail” Mobile Game Announced

GameSamba, NGames Interactive Limited, and Funimation Entertainment have announced today that they are working with Kodansha to develop and publish an officially licensed mobile game based on the hit “Fairy Tail” franchise. The “Fairy Tail” game will be available in multiple languages worldwide on Android and iOS devices, and is expected to be released by the end of 2016.

“’Fairy Tail’ is one of our favorite franchises, and we look forward to working with NGames and Funimation to create a game fans will love,” said Scott Wong, President and Co-Founder of GameSamba.

The game will be a mobile RPG featuring a new side story that draws from the sequel series of the anime. Players will recruit and battle against their favorite characters from “Fairy Tail,” in order to form the most powerful team of wizards.

In addition to the new mobile game, GameSamba and Funimation previously announced an upcoming web-based free-to-play MMORPG based on “Fairy Tail.” NGames will also work with the two companies to help develop that title. The new mobile and web games will be independent of each other.

Star Wars: Uprising Review

Star Wars: Uprising is set shortly after the events of Star Wars: Episode VI Return of the Jedi and deals with the aftermath of the Battle of Endor, which saw the death of Darth Sidious and Darth Vader. The Galactic Empire, reeling from its loss, locks down the Anoat sector. A rogue band of resistance fighters comes together to create an uprising against the Empire in the sector.
